1. Introduction
This document defines the functions and the interfaces provided by the BMC software on an IPU-M2000.
Note
Note that setting a power cap is an advance preview feature in the current versions of the IPU-M2000.
To access the BMC, you will need the following information from the system administrator:
BMC host name or IP address
OpenBMC user ID and password
Initially, there will a single default user account on the BMC. When you log in as that user you can create further accounts, if you wish (see Section 9, User management).
1.1. BMC command line interface
To use the command-line interface, you must be logged in to the BMC via SSH or the serial console.
The command line interface uses either standard Linux commands or the ipum_utils
command.
1.2. Graphical user interface
A graphical user interface (GUI) to the BMC is available. You can access this with a web browser.
1.3. REST API
You can send REST API commands using curl
or the openbmctool.py
command line tool on
the host server.
OpenBMC recommends token-based authentication when using the REST interface and provides some command examples, including power related operations. See the “OpenBMC cheatsheet”. A successful REST command results in a “200 OK” message as shown below:
{
"data": null,
"message": "200 OK",
"status": "ok"
}
1.4. IPMI
You can use the the ipmitool
to control the BMC over IPMI. You can download this from
https://github.com/ipmitool/ipmitool.
1.5. Redfish
The Redfish standard is a suite of specifications that deliver an industry standard protocol providing a RESTful interface for the management of servers, storage and networking.
The IPU-M2000 BMC supports a Redfish basic profile. You can perform operations through the
Redfish interface by sending curl
queries to the URI. You can also use a browser to
access the Redfish GUI.
